A Senior Network Engineer is a key player in maintaining, optimizing, and securing an organization’s network systems. They oversee the design, implementation, and management of network infrastructure, ensuring its stability and performance. A skilled Senior Network Engineer brings advanced knowledge of networking protocols, security measures, and hardware, providing solutions to complex network problems.
What is a Senior Network Engineer?
A Senior Network Engineer is a seasoned IT professional responsible for designing, implementing, and managing an organization’s network systems. This role requires deep expertise in various network technologies and a comprehensive understanding of network infrastructure, including hardware, software, and security systems. Senior Network Engineers take the lead on complex projects, ensuring networks operate efficiently, and securely, and are capable of scaling to meet the growing demands of the business. They also manage troubleshooting, upgrades, and optimization of network systems while mentoring junior engineers and collaborating with cross-functional teams.
Senior Network Engineer Responsibilities Include
- Designing, implementing, and maintaining complex network infrastructure to ensure scalability, reliability, and security.
- Managing and troubleshooting network performance, including monitoring traffic, analyzing network data, and resolving issues.
- Overseeing network security, including configuring firewalls, VPNs, and intrusion detection systems (IDS).
- Collaborating with other IT teams to design network solutions that meet organizational needs and integrate with other systems.
- Implementing network policies and procedures to ensure network compliance, security, and best practices.
- Leading and mentoring junior network engineers, providing guidance and technical expertise.
- Planning and managing network upgrades, migrations, and expansions in a cost-effective manner.
- Analyzing and optimizing the performance of network systems to improve efficiency and reduce downtime.
- Conducting regular network audits to assess and improve system performance and security.
- Ensuring disaster recovery plans are in place for network systems and services.
- Staying up-to-date with the latest networking technologies, industry trends, and best practices.
Job Title: Senior Network Engineer
Job Introduction
We are looking for a Senior Network Engineer to join our team. The ideal candidate will have extensive experience in designing, implementing, and managing network infrastructure. As a Senior Network Engineer, you will take the lead on network projects, ensuring system stability, security, and efficiency. You will also work closely with other IT teams to create and maintain scalable network solutions that support the company’s growth.
Responsibilities:
- Design, implement, and maintain large-scale network infrastructure, ensuring optimal performance and security.
- Troubleshoot and resolve network-related issues, including hardware and software malfunctions.
- Configure and manage routers, switches, firewalls, and other networking equipment.
- Lead network performance monitoring and analysis to identify bottlenecks and optimize traffic.
- Develop and enforce network security policies, including firewalls, VPNs, and encryption techniques.
- Work with cross-functional teams to integrate network solutions with other IT systems.
- Conduct capacity planning and manage network expansions to ensure scalability.
- Oversee network backups and disaster recovery planning, ensuring minimal downtime.
- Train and mentor junior network engineers, providing ongoing guidance and support.
- Prepare detailed documentation for network configurations, designs, and troubleshooting procedures.
- Stay informed about emerging network technologies and security trends, integrating them into the infrastructure as needed.
Requirements:
- Bachelor’s degree in Computer Science, Information Technology, or a related field.
- 5+ years of experience as a Network Engineer, with at least 2 years in a senior or lead role.
- Strong experience with networking hardware (routers, switches, firewalls, load balancers, etc.).
- Expertise in network protocols such as TCP/IP, DNS, DHCP, and VPN.
- Proficiency in network security technologies, including firewalls, intrusion detection/prevention, and encryption.
- Experience with cloud networking and virtualization technologies.
- Solid understanding of network monitoring tools (e.g., Wireshark, Nagios, SolarWinds).
- Excellent troubleshooting skills with the ability to diagnose and resolve complex network issues.
- Strong communication and collaboration skills for working with IT teams and business stakeholders.
- Certifications such as Cisco Certified Network Professional (CCNP), CompTIA Network+, or similar are a plus.
Conclusion
This Senior Network Engineer job description template will help you attract experienced candidates who can design, manage, and optimize your network infrastructure. By customizing this JD to your company’s needs, you can ensure that you find the right talent for the role. Once your job description is ready, consider using Cleveri’s AI-driven Candidate Screening and Video Interviewing platform to simplify your hiring process. Cleveri’s platform uses advanced algorithms to match candidates to your job requirements, streamlining candidate screening. It also supports video interviews, allowing you to assess both technical and soft skills effectively and efficiently.